One of three available trim levels, the 3.6L R-S is equipped with features such as ABS (Anti-lock Brake System), Advanced Air Bags System (AABS), 6 Airbags, Anti-theft alarm, Central Locking, Cupholders, Electric Sunroof, Fabric Seats, Chrome Plated Radiator Grille, Cornering Lights, Daytime Running Lights - LED, Door Mirrors with Side Turn Signal, Ambient Lighting, Apps, Audio Controls on Steering Wheel, and Auto Dimming Mirror.
This Japanese Sedan is powered by a 3.6-litre 6-cylinder petrol engine that generates an impressive 257 horsepower and 350 Nm of torque. In comparison, the Honda Accord and Nissan Altima come with 2.4-litre and 2.5-litre engines, respectively.
